作者: Seunghwi Kim Andrea Alù Photonics Initiative Advanced Science Research Center City University of New York New York New York USA Physics Program Graduate Center City University of New York New York NY USA
Non-monochromatic excitations oscillating at complex frequencies can overcome the limits imposed by passivity. We discuss a few examples in which this approach can be successfully implemented in nanophotonic platforms.
